Solution for 11(2y-3)=2(4y-16) equation:


Simplifying
11(2y + -3) = 2(4y + -16)

Reorder the terms:
11(-3 + 2y) = 2(4y + -16)
(-3 * 11 + 2y * 11) = 2(4y + -16)
(-33 + 22y) = 2(4y + -16)

Reorder the terms:
-33 + 22y = 2(-16 + 4y)
-33 + 22y = (-16 * 2 + 4y * 2)
-33 + 22y = (-32 + 8y)

Solving
-33 + 22y = -32 + 8y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-8y' to each side of the equation.
-33 + 22y + -8y = -32 + 8y + -8y

Combine like terms: 22y + -8y = 14y
-33 + 14y = -32 + 8y + -8y

Combine like terms: 8y + -8y = 0
-33 + 14y = -32 + 0
-33 + 14y = -32

Add '33' to each side of the equation.
-33 + 33 + 14y = -32 + 33

Combine like terms: -33 + 33 = 0
0 + 14y = -32 + 33
14y = -32 + 33

Combine like terms: -32 + 33 = 1
14y = 1

Divide each side by '14'.
y = 0.07142857143

Simplifying
y = 0.07142857143
